Definitions:

Population Standard Deviation

A measure of the dispersion or variability in a population data set.

Confidence Interval

A range of values, derived from sample data, that is believed to contain the true population parameter with a certain level of confidence.

Sample Mean

The mean of all data points within a sample, utilized to approximate the mean of the entire population.

After-Tax Profit

The net profit of a company after all taxes have been deducted from revenues.
